Biography
Dr. John Coles received his medical degree from the University of Western Ontario, and his FRCSC in Cardiovascular and Thoracic Surgery in 1982. He has had internships and residencies in Vancouver, London, and Toronto. Dr. Coles joined the SickKids team in 1984 as a consulting staff surgeon, taking on a position in the Research Institute in 1990. He also works in the academic community as a professor in the Department of Surgery at the University of Toronto. The research environment is very supportive of the clinical aspects of The Hospital for Sick Children, which is why Dr. Coles enjoys working here. As both a researcher and a surgeon, he is a witness to how research can influence clinical care.
Research Interest
His research studies are directed towards understanding the molecular biology of hypertrophy which occurs in congenital heart disease
